MySQL索引优化不当导致的性能瓶颈
在MySQL中,索引是数据库查询性能的关键因素。如果索引优化不当,可能会导致以下几种性能瓶颈:
查询效率低下:没有或者不正确的索引,可能导致对表数据进行全扫描,大大降低查询速度。
插入和删除慢:每次插入或删除数据时,系统可能需要对索引重新构建,这会导致操作变慢。
索引空间浪费:如果创建了过多的冗余索引,不仅会占用额外的空间,还会影响查询性能。
因此,正确地设计和管理数据库索引是避免MySQL性能瓶颈的关键。
在MySQL中,索引是数据库查询性能的关键因素。如果索引优化不当,可能会导致以下几种性能瓶颈:
查询效率低下:没有或者不正确的索引,可能导致对表数据进行全扫描,大大降低查询速度。
插入和删除慢:每次插入或删除数据时,系统可能需要对索引重新构建,这会导致操作变慢。
索引空间浪费:如果创建了过多的冗余索引,不仅会占用额外的空间,还会影响查询性能。
因此,正确地设计和管理数据库索引是避免MySQL性能瓶颈的关键。
在MySQL中,索引是提高查询速度的重要手段。如果索引优化不当,可能会导致以下几种情况,从而引发性能瓶颈: 1. **冗余索引**:创建了多个对同一列的索引,这既占用存储空间
案例描述: 在一个典型的电子商务网站中,数据库性能是一个至关重要的环节。这里我们以一个常见的场景为例:商品搜索。 1. **原始设置**: - 未对商品名称创建索引。
在Oracle数据库中,索引是提高查询性能的重要工具。如果索引优化不当,确实会出现以下问题,从而形成性能瓶颈: 1. 无效或重复索引:如果创建了多个具有相同列的索引,这些索引
在MySQL中,索引是数据库查询性能的关键因素。如果索引优化不当,可能会导致以下几种性能瓶颈: 1. 查询效率低下:没有或者不正确的索引,可能导致对表数据进行全扫描,大大降低
MySQL索引是数据库优化的重要工具,如果索引优化不当,确实可能导致查询性能下降。以下是一些可能导致这种情况的原因: 1. **无效或冗余索引**:创建了对数据列的重复或不必
在MySQL中,索引是提升查询效率的重要手段。如果索引优化不足,可能会导致以下几种性能瓶颈实例: 1. **全表扫描**:当查询条件不能利用已建索引时,可能会执行全表扫描,效
案例:一家电商网站在处理大量用户搜索请求时,出现了明显的性能瓶颈。经排查,问题主要出在数据库索引管理上。 1. **情况描述**: 网站的搜索功能使用了MySQL的一个
案例描述: 假设我们有一个典型的电子商务应用,主要的表是`products`和`orders`。 1. 产品表`products`:如果每个产品都有多个属性(如颜色、尺寸等
在MySQL中,索引是一种数据结构,用于加快查询速度。但如果使用不当,可能会导致性能瓶颈。以下是一些常见的问题和优化策略: 1. **过多的索引**:虽然每个表都应该有适当的
在MySQL中,索引是提升查询性能的重要工具。如果索引设计不当,可能会成为性能瓶颈: 1. **冗余索引**:创建了多个对同一列的索引,会导致空间浪费,且每次插入数据时都需要
还没有评论,来说两句吧...